Transaction d72ad1ac8f7103c99f23dafdf43a1e07188c323126396ff252434729ea04e958

2 Input
1 Outputs
  • d72ad1ac8f7103c99f23dafdf43a1e07188c323126396ff252434729ea04e958:0
  • value  12745467
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u